For Google ChromeSM users, there is a simple solution called BlockIt©. This Internet browser security extension restricts access to certain websites so dangerous or inappropriate content cannot be reached. The instructions below explain how to install the BlockIt© add-on and block the websites you want.
Install and set up the BlockIt© add-on:
- Launch Google ChromeSM and go to the BlockIt© page on the Softpedia®.
- Download the latest BlockIt© version.
- When asked if you want to add BlockIt© to your browser, add it.
- In the URL/address bar type “chrome://extensions” and press enter.
- Click on the “Options” button.
- You will be redirected to the password page of the extension. The first time you use it, you don’t enter a password because you don’t have one. Just click on the “Login” button.
- Now enter the name of the websites you want to block and click on the “Block” button.
You can type in a list of addresses and block them all at once by clicking on the “Block All” button. - Now set a password so no one can unblock your settings by clicking the “Change Access Password” section located at the bottom of the page.
- Once completed, you may logout. Any addresses you entered will now be blocked.
